Accra: Chief of Staff Julius Debrah has earned a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) in Museum and Heritage Studies from the University of Ghana. He was awarded the doctorate during the university's School of Graduate Studies congregation held at the Great Hall on Saturday, July 25, 2026.
According to Ghana Web, President John Dramani Mahama attended the University of Ghana's July 2026 graduation ceremony at the Great Hall, where he joined the academic procession in support of the graduands. The achievement adds another academic milestone to Julius Debrah's career.
Julius Debrah's academic accomplishment comes alongside his previous roles in government. He served as Minister of Local Government and Rural Development from 2014 to 2015, and as Regional Minister for the Eastern and Greater Accra Regions from 2013 to 2014.
